  • Patent number: 7296260
    Abstract: A system and method for composing a multi-lingual instructional software is disclosed. The software includes interface components, lingual components and exercise banks to be linked and compiled dynamically upon user's requests of an original language and a target language, so that a plurality of combinations of lingual instructional materials can be obtained from a single software according to the user's requirements.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 26, 2003
    Date of Patent: November 13, 2007
    Assignee: Inventec Corporation
    Inventors: Sayling Wen, Zechary Chang, Pinky Ma, Bing Bian
  • Publication number: 20060242107
    Abstract: A method and a system for sharing a digital database. The system has a client platform, a server platform and a network. The database of the client platform has the same data format as the database of the server platform. Via the network, database sharing between the client platform and the server platform is performed, such that the storage space occupied by the digital data is reduced.
    Type: Application
    Filed: April 25, 2005
    Publication date: October 26, 2006
    Inventors: Zechary Chang, Bing Bian, Pinky Ma
  • Publication number: 20060150213
    Abstract: An executing module and method thereof for playing multimedia in a wireless communication apparatus are provided, so that the user can play various multimedia operations in the wireless communication apparatus. Firstly, obtain an animation data. Next, retrieve information data according to one of the animation messages in the animation data. Next, execute the information data. Then, such steps are repeated until all the animation messages in the animation data are executed.
    Type: Application
    Filed: December 16, 2004
    Publication date: July 6, 2006
    Inventors: Zechary Chang, Ken Kung, Bing Bian
  • Publication number: 20060142087
    Abstract: A system and method for network-loading game data includes a server and a client. The server includes a databank for storing game data. The client includes a game engine; a search module to search corresponding game data from the databank according to control commands generated by the game engine; and a storage module to store the searched corresponding game data for the game engine to use. Therefore, the game engine and the game data are separated, and the game data are real-time loaded from the server when the client runs the game program.
    Type: Application
    Filed: December 23, 2004
    Publication date: June 29, 2006
    Applicant: Inventec Corporation
    Inventors: Zechary Chang, Ken Kung, Bing Bian
  • Publication number: 20060084503
    Abstract: A system of automatically generating personalized games and the method thereof are provided. Using a server/user structure, a game controller connects a user to a database server. The server includes a game database for storing game data and a game controller for implementing logic controls. The user has a user engine for implementing a user interface that provides a visualized interface and communicates with the game controller. Thus, characters and scenes can be created according to the user's settings, rendering a personalized game.
    Type: Application
    Filed: September 12, 2005
    Publication date: April 20, 2006
    Inventors: Bing Bian, Ken Kung, Zechary Chang
